YRC Teamster Dues Go Down

January 28, 2009: The International Union has directed locals to reduce the dues of YRC Teamsters by $6 per month to take account of the pay cut which went into effect retroactively to January 1.

The memo states that locals can choose to implement the new dues rate in January, February or March. While many locals need money, we think it’s only fair to reduce the dues in January, when the pay cut took effect.

Many Teamsters have suggested that James Hoffa, Tom Keegel, Tyson Johnson and other International Union leaders should take their own 10% salary cut, to save our union money and show solidarity with Teamster members in these difficult times.

Teamster History – As Told by those Who Made it Happen

The IBT has launched the Teamster History Project, which includes 27 unedited interviews with Teamsters who made it happen. It covers the years 1975-1999.  Those interviewed include several TDU leaders, participants in the Carey administration, James Hoffa, along with two Hoffa lieutenants who were expelled from the union for corruption and self-dealing.
